WOODVILLE RACES

CONCLUDING DAY SHREWD COMES HOME IN GOTHARD MEMORIAL HANDICAP JUVENILE TO WAIT AND SEE Woodville, Thursday. The seeond and concluding day of the Woodville Jockey Club's summer meeting was held to-day in fine weather. There was a fair attendanee, and the track was in excellent order.
